Interestingly, this is not the first time when the star player has expressed her love for the season or has flaunted her Halloween-special attire. 

 

Ahead of the WTA finals last year, Coco Gauff opened up on her passion for Halloween in a pre-tournament conference. “I’ve always been passionate about Halloween since I was a kid. I always loved to dress up. I would do it, like, year-round. I’ve always talked about wanting to go to [do] cosplay, the conventions, and all of that.” Gauff said in Cancun. In 2021, Gauff was also seen dressing up as Velma, which she considers as one of her favorite efforts. Her passion for Halloween was witnessed in the subsequent years as well. 

In 2022, Coco touched upon her inner mystic self and dressed as Raven from “Teen Titans.” She also tried her hands at being a movie villain in 2023 and took the internet by storm. But while Gauff is extremely enthusiastic about the spooky season, her family is not much of a fan of Halloween.

When Coco Gauff revealed forcing her family to dress up for Halloween

Coco Gauff’s passion for style has often come to light. Be it dazzling up off-court events or dressing up for Halloween, the star player has never shied away from expressing herself. However, she revealed that her family is not as excited as her when it comes to Halloween, and she often ends up forcing them to dress up for the season. 

Speaking in the same interview ahead of the WTA Finals last year, Gauff revealed, “With my family, honestly only three members of my family, or two, one actually, Cameron is the only one who is really keen to doing it. The rest I just kind of force to do it.” Last year, she claimed that her family members were not even ready for basic dress-up.

We have some funny videos of us trying to get pictures together. My dad is fed up. Codey is fed up. They don’t care about Halloween that much, but they do it for me. You can see their costumes are the least effort amount. This year they just had to put on a mask,” Gauff shared.
